About the role
Supports the overall mission of the United States Attorney's Office (USAO) by receiving, gathering, analyzing, and organizing information from multiple sources.
Responsibilities
- Receives, gathers, analyzes, and organizes information from multiple sources
- Ensures completeness of received information and reconciles inconsistencies
- Accurately enters required data into one or more databases, documents, or spreadsheets
- Establishes and maintains physical files
- Keeps track of case file status in order to ensure compliance with established deadlines
- Coordinates requests for additional information as needed
- Selects relevant information from a variety of sources in order to prepare documents, reports, summaries, and replies to inquiries, ensuring accuracy and proper format of the information provided
- Performs word processing relevant to case
- Provides accurate and timely status updates
- Performs other duties as assigned
